Output df23ad8655e1c7248669586c3ea61a8c275dc6988955687a234c3d18937cc926:20

value
286770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0669e69ce73672902232b1dcf7ea86c8c17cb3 OP_EQUAL
address
3PJHkdvt6eYgUooLkYv5X1yKYetePf3Ych
transaction
df23ad8655e1c7248669586c3ea61a8c275dc6988955687a234c3d18937cc926
spent
true